Definition of calyx

Calyx (n.) A cuplike division of the pelvis of the kidney, which surrounds one or more of the renal papillae..

Corolla :: Corolla (n.) The inner envelope of a flower; the part which surrounds the organs of fructification, consisting of one or more leaves, called petals. It is usually distinguished from the calyx by the fineness of its texture and the gayness of its colors. See the Note under Blossom..
Labiate :: Labiate (a.) Having the limb of a tubular corolla or calyx divided into two unequal parts, one projecting over the other like the lips of a mouth, as in the snapdragon, sage, and catnip..
Lacinia :: Lacinia (n.) A narrow, slender portion of the edge of a monophyllous calyx, or of any irregularly incised leaf..
Corolliflorous :: Corolliflorous (a.) Having the stamens borne on the petals, and the latter free from the calyx. Compare Calycifloral and Thalamifloral..
Spathed :: Spathed (a.) Having a spathe or calyx like a sheath.
Octofid :: Octofid (a.) Cleft or separated into eight segments, as a calyx..
Larkspur :: Larkspur (n.) A genus of ranunculaceous plants (Delphinium), having showy flowers, and a spurred calyx. They are natives of the North Temperate zone. The commonest larkspur of the gardens is D. Consolida. The flower of the bee larkspur (D. elatum) has two petals bearded with yellow hairs, and looks not unlike a bee..
Roselle :: Roselle (n.) a malvaceous plant (Hibiscus Sabdariffa) cultivated in the east and West Indies for its fleshy calyxes, which are used for making tarts and jelly and an acid drink..
Dichlamydeous :: Dichlamydeous (a.) Having two coverings, a calyx and in corolla..
Skullcap :: Skullcap (n.) Any plant of the labiate genus Scutellaria, the calyx of whose flower appears, when inverted, like a helmet with the visor raised..
Calycine :: Calycine (a.) Pertaining to a calyx; having the nature of a calyx.
Sepaloid :: Sepaloid (a.) Like a sepal, or a division of a calyx..
Calyx :: Calyx (n.) A cuplike division of the pelvis of the kidney, which surrounds one or more of the renal papillae..
Calyx :: Calyx (n.) The covering of a flower. See Flower.
Cynarrhodium :: Cynarrhodium (n.) A fruit like that of the rose, consisting of a cup formed of the calyx tube and receptacle, and containing achenes..
Calyxes :: Calyxes (pl. ) of Caly.
Inserted :: Inserted (a.) Situated upon, attached to, or growing out of, some part; -- said especially of the parts of the flower; as, the calyx, corolla, and stamens of many flowers are inserted upon the receptacle..
Carinated :: Carinated (a.) Shaped like the keel or prow of a ship; having a carina or keel; as, a carinate calyx or leaf; a carinate sternum (of a bird)..
Denticulated :: Denticulated (a.) Furnished with denticles; notched into little toothlike projections; as, a denticulate leaf of calyx..
Calyciform :: Calyciform (a.) Having the form or appearance of a calyx.
